The blue turmeric plant is a fascinating member of the ginger genus, originating from the Western Ghats of India and sections of Sri Lanka. This long-lived herbaceous plant is generally cultivated for its scented rhizomes, which possess a vibrant, deep indigo hue – a characteristic distinctive in the Curcuma family. Aside from its striking color, the rhizomes are historically used in Ayurvedic medicine and cooking, though its consumption is careful due to potential harmful effects if not properly prepared. It often reaches a height of roughly 60-90 cm, developing creamy-white blooms on a primary stalk. Growing generally requires shady conditions and nutrient-dense soil to grow.

Distribution and Environment of Curcuma caesia
Curcuma caesia, also known as the "cian ginger" or "barley herb", exhibits a somewhat restricted range, primarily concentrated in the Western Ghats of India and Sri Lanka. Usually, its presence is noted in the moist, shaded understories of warm forests. These forests often experience substantial rainfall – usually surpassing 2000 mm annually – and are characterized by high humidity. While it's occasionally found at lower elevations, Curcuma caesia flourishes best between 300 and 1500 meters at sea level. A preference for nutrient-dense soils, often derived from laterite or decayed organic matter, is also a defining feature of its habitat. The plant's ability to tolerate consistent dampness and limited sunlight contributes to its specialized ecological position. Recent surveys suggest declining populations due to habitat loss and unregulated collection, further emphasizing the need for conservation efforts.
